Transaction dc907162607c92ad013e77da9b9d7754c0625c2561bbf4d56d9f91c27d8499ed
1 Input
1 Output
-
dc907162607c92ad013e77da9b9d7754c0625c2561bbf4d56d9f91c27d8499ed:0
- value
- 8890
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 dd5368c96cef8b4f039c195817876e20549bece057a9025a26854077083bcaa7
- address
- bc1pm4fk3jtva7957quur9vp0pmwyp2fhm8q275syk3xs4q8wzpme2nsmqqewe